重新认识JAVA基础(1),初识Java - Go语言中文社区

重新认识JAVA基础(1),初识Java


重新开始学习JAVA,重新理一下java基础的概念点

软件就是的概念就是 : 指令+数据

软件就是由一堆指令 和 一堆数据组成。

Java的背景之类的一堆废话:

     1:Java是SUN公司研发的,现在被Oracle公司收购了

     2 :91年研发,95年发布

     3:Java 名字的由来: 一开始Java的名字叫Oak ,后来注册商标的时候,被抢先注册了,然后Java之父高司令开会在想名字的时候,想起来在开发的时候经常在喝爪哇佬的咖啡,陪伴着他们的开发,为了纪念这个,起名为Java,所以Java的商标就是一个咖啡杯。

Java在95年发布了java1.0,后第二代发布了分为三大平台J2EE,J2SE,J2ME。

在Java6的时候正式改为三大平台:

                                 JavaSE:标准版---基础

                                 JavaEE:企业版---目标

                                 JavaME:小型版---淘汰了

Java的特点:

                              1.安全,开源(源代码均可见)

                              2.面向对象

                              3.跨平台性(可移植性)

平台即为操作系统,即为可以在不同的操作系统平台上运行。

原理:Java虚拟机(jvm)---程序执行者(只要有Java虚拟机的设备就可以运行Java程序)

环境搭建:

JVM:java虚拟机---执行程序

JRE:Java运行环境,包括:jvm+核心类库

JDK: Java开发工具包,包括:jre+开发工具

关系如下(图画的有点丑见谅):

具体环境变量的配置和jdk的安装看我的另外一篇文章

https://mp.csdn.net/postedit/81175330

编写程序步骤:
    1.创建一个.java文件
    2.编写源代码文件
    3.编译源文件          javac   源文件名.java  --- 语法(单词是否拼写正确,符号..)
    4.执行类文件          java    类名         ---逻辑
    
    注意:java区分大小写
          符号、字母等都是英文的

    
    修饰符  class  类名{
        public static void main(String[] args){
            .....
        }
    }

    1.class 左边要么不写,默认修饰符,类名与源文件名可以不一样
        左边要么public,类是公共类,要求类名和源文件名必须一模一样
    2.一个源文件中可以写多个类,有且只有一个类可以用public修饰,并且源文件名与之相同
    3.一个类中要么没有,要么只能有一个main方法

    规范:
        1.类名:
            单词首字母大写,如果是多个,每个单词首字母大写,单词间没有空格
        2.注意缩进
 

版权声明:本文来源CSDN,感谢博主原创文章,遵循 CC 4.0 by-sa 版权协议,转载请附上原文出处链接和本声明。
原文链接:https://blog.csdn.net/m0_37729047/article/details/81225758
站方申明:本站部分内容来自社区用户分享,若涉及侵权,请联系站方删除。
  • 发表于 2020-04-19 17:42:29
  • 阅读 ( 1072 )
  • 分类:

0 条评论

请先 登录 后评论

官方社群

GO教程

猜你喜欢